Jake’s Take | Success in Sales

What do interpersonal social skills, project management skills, and technical skills all have in common? They’re the three ingredients that make a successful salesperson. 

This week, we’re challenging you to evaluate these skills in your team. How strong are they and how can you make them stronger? Jake says these are the most important skills of this decade.

In the News

Last week we shared a special recap about the injustices and brutality against black people tearing through our country and what we can do to make a change. Voices should not stop. Many companies have been taking a stand against racism and supporting the Black Lives Matter movement happening in our country right now. 

Most notably, 

  • Lego donated $4 million and pulled advertising for police-related products. 
  • Ben & Jerry’s posted a statement on Twitter condemning white supremacy and voicing their support of the movement.

Jake emphasizes how important it is for sales leaders to not be silent, which can come in many forms. Push prejudice out of your organization and welcome diversity. Speak out about opportunities for Black people. History is watching us right now, what side do you want to be on?
